引言
在现代网络环境中,Xray和V2Ray作为两种流行的网络代理工具,越来越受到用户的青睐。它们不仅可以帮助用户实现科学上网,还提供了多种功能以增强网络安全性和隐私保护。本文将深入探讨这两种工具的特点、安装步骤、配置方法以及常见问题解答。
Xray与V2Ray的概述
什么是Xray?
Xray是一个基于V2Ray的网络代理工具,旨在提供更高效的网络连接和更强的隐私保护。它支持多种协议和传输方式,能够灵活应对不同的网络环境。
什么是V2Ray?
V2Ray是一个功能强大的网络代理工具,支持多种协议(如VMess、Shadowsocks等)和传输方式(如TCP、WebSocket等)。它的设计目标是提供一个灵活、可扩展的网络代理解决方案。
Xray与V2Ray的主要功能
- 多协议支持:支持VMess、Shadowsocks、Trojan等多种协议。
- 灵活的传输方式:支持TCP、WebSocket、HTTP/2等多种传输方式。
- 负载均衡:可以通过多条线路实现负载均衡,提高网络稳定性。
- 动态端口:支持动态端口功能,增强隐私保护。
- 多用户管理:支持多用户配置,适合团队使用。
Xray与V2Ray的安装步骤
安装Xray
- 下载Xray:访问Xray的GitHub页面下载最新版本。
- 解压文件:将下载的压缩包解压到指定目录。
- 配置文件:根据需要创建或修改配置文件(config.json)。
- 运行Xray:在终端中运行
./xray run -c config.json
命令启动Xray。
安装V2Ray
- 下载V2Ray:访问V2Ray的GitHub页面下载最新版本。
- 解压文件:将下载的压缩包解压到指定目录。
- 配置文件:根据需要创建或修改配置文件(config.json)。
- 运行V2Ray:在终端中运行
./v2ray run -c config.json
命令启动V2Ray。
Xray与V2Ray的配置方法
配置Xray
- 基本配置:在config.json中设置inbounds和outbounds,定义入站和出站的代理规则。
- 用户管理:可以在配置文件中添加多个用户,设置不同的权限。
- 路由设置:通过配置路由规则,实现流量的分流和管理。
配置V2Ray
- 基本配置:在config.json中设置inbounds和outbounds,定义入站和出站的代理规则。
- 用户管理:可以在配置文件中添加多个用户,设置不同的权限。
- 路由设置:通过配置路由规则,实现流量的分流和管理。
常见问题解答(FAQ)
Xray和V2Ray有什么区别?
Xray是基于V2Ray的一个分支,提供了更多的功能和优化。虽然两者在基本功能上相似,但Xray在性能和安全性上有一定的提升。
如何选择Xray或V2Ray?
选择Xray或V2Ray主要取决于用户的需求。如果需要更高的性能和更多的功能,建议使用Xray;如果只需要基本的代理功能,V2Ray也足够使用。
Xray和V2Ray
正文完